Transaction e8f3dba25219f1a809a01774a139056b30c305863bac3d5d837a40bdea3deef4
1 Input
1 Output
-
e8f3dba25219f1a809a01774a139056b30c305863bac3d5d837a40bdea3deef4:0
- value
- 69799670
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ef15592d740829f064cfbfcd35399c491f071fda
- address
- ltc1qau24jtt5pq5lqex0hlxn2wvufy0sw876verl8c